40:62-14. The rates, rents, connections fees, or charges shall remain, until paid, municipal liens against the property and premises where such light, heat or power is furnished, and shall draw interest at the rate of seven per cent per annum from and after the time when they shall become due, and shall, in addition to all other remedies, be collectible in the same manner as arrearages of taxes.
